§ 29-1-19-7 — Appointment of guardian; condition precedent to payment of veterans' benefits; incapacitated person

Text

Where a petition is filed for the appointment of a guardian for an incapacitated person, a certificate of the administrator or the administrator's duly authorized representative that the person has been rated incompetent or incapacitated by the Department on examination in accordance with the laws and regulations governing the Department and that the appointment of a guardian or the issuance of a protective order is a condition precedent to the payment of money due the protected person by the Department shall be prima facie evidence of the necessity for the appointment. Formerly: Acts 1953, c.112, s.2007. As amended by P.L.33-1989, SEC.44.
